#586ef6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#586ef6 is composed of 34.5% red, 43.1%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 55.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 231.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 65.5%. #586ef6 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0dcff with #0000ed.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#586ef6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#586ef6 has RGB values of R:88, G:110,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5795574.

Hex triplet 586ef6 #586ef6
RGB Decimal 88, 110, 246 rgb(88,110,246)
RGB Percent 34.5, 43.1, 96.5 rgb(34.5%,43.1%,96.5%)
CMYK 64, 55, 0, 4
HSL 231.6°, 89.8, 65.5 hsl(231.6,89.8%,65.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 231.6°, 64.2, 96.5
Web Safe 6666ff #6666ff
CIE-LAB 51.7, 33.725, -70.721
XYZ 26.232, 19.879, 89.638
xyY 0.193, 0.146, 19.879
CIE-LCH 51.7, 78.351, 295.495
CIE-LUV 51.7, -14.112, -112.107
Hunter-Lab 44.586, 26.993, -87.991
Binary 01011000, 01101110, 11110110

Shades and Tints of #586ef6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#edeffe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#586ef6 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#777777 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#717590 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#007ef7 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#0084d9 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#008e98 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#2078f6 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#207ce3 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#2082ba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
